Howdy Guys,
XR4 is going in for it 15,000km service on Monday, and I'll mention it to the dealer then, but is anybody elses XR4 a bit rough at idle, espicially with the air con on? Sitting at the lights and mine is constantly going back and forth between 900 - 1000rpm. I wouldn't mind it if I was driving a cammed monster but since it's a stock XR4 :p Also - is anybody elses XR4 crappy on when cold? It's almost like driving a carby car sometimes, needing to give it some gas etc. PS. 6 months on and I REALLY miss RWD & power :( |

Sounds alot like your ECU needs a reset or flash. That or a sensor is faulty.
A healthy ECU will adjust idle in about 0.5 seconds and keep it steady.
